What Is reflect.finance? Overview, Features, and Benefits RFI
reflect.finance (RFI) uses an automated reward protocol on the Ethereum blockchain. The project processes frictionless yield distribution to token holders. RFI integrates smart contract-based tokenomics and operates fully decentralized.
Network design
RFI operates on Ethereum as an ERC-20 token. It uses a reflection mechanism to distribute transaction fees automatically. Smart contracts process all rewards. No staking or external interaction is required.

reflect.finance framework
The reflect.finance framework processes a static reward model. Each RFI transaction incurs a fee, which the contract redistributes proportionally. This mechanism increases each holder's balance over time. The protocol requires no manual claiming of rewards. Smart contracts manage all allocations automatically.
